Knee Joint PainWhat is the reason for my knee pain?

I had an MRI, X-rays and others, but there is no reason why I had this pain. I was taking a tablet called Advil and have put a patch that numbs the area of my knee. These are only temporary relief. Please advise on my problem and if there are solutions. Thank you

I was in the same boat as you. I hurt my knee at the race and I went and had X-rays and lots of other tests and they said my knee was fine. I discovered that I was losing muscle mass overcompensation. My knee has not had adequate muscle support to keep my kneecap (patella) in his way, he rubbed the origin of this pain in my knee unreal.

I went to a therapist because I was tired of being told there was nothing wrong. They gave me some stretching exercises and very good to help strengthen the muscles that support the knee.
